There's a ribbon of blue fruit which cruises through the core of this wine - delish! A great little Shiraz from Blue Pyrenees.
The fruit is juicy and forward. Some blackberries and dark chocolate jostle for attention but its those blue fruits which keep me in the hunt. A menthol/eucalypt character simmers along with the fruit parcel being neatly wrapped up by fine spices which just hang. It's comes across quite polished, but regardless, it's a tasty wine now and one which will benefit from some bottle age too. Great stuff!
Drink to five years+
92/100
Region: Pyrenees
RRP: $28
Source: Sample
